Notification 9 April 1999

S.O. 242(E)

Following areas specified under section 139

What this is

S.O. 242(E) was published on 9 April 1999. Its subject is Following areas specified under section 139.

This notifies a named person, body, fund or instrument for the purpose of a provision. Nothing in it changes the provision itself.

The instrument, as the Board published it

The words below are the department’s own, reproduced from its published text. Where the department’s copy carried a publisher’s notes after the instrument, those are not reproduced.

In exercise of the powers conferred by the first proviso to sub-section (1) of section 139 of the Income-tax Act, 1961 (43 of 196 1), the Central Board of Direct Taxes hereby specifies the following areas for the purposes of the said proviso, namely:---

Urban agglomeration of---

(1) Amritsar including the areas in Municipal Corporation of Amritsar as notified by the Punjab State Government under sub-rule (3) of rule 3 of the Punjab Municipal Corporation Act, 1971, and including the areas under the Cantonment Board, Amritsar, as notified by the Central Government under section 3 of the Cantonment Act, 1924 ;

(2) Asansol including the areas comprised in the Municipal Corporation of Asansol ;

(3) Aurangabad including the areas comprised in the Municipal Corporation of Aurangabad as constituted under the Bombay Provincial Municipal Corporation Act, 1949 (LIX of 1949) ;

(4) Bareilly including areas comprised in the city of Bareilly, within the meaning of Bareilly Development Authority, as notified by the Government of Uttar Pradesh.

(5) Durg including the areas as notified in the Notification No. 291/18-1/81, dated March 31, 1981; and Bhilai including areas as notified as per Notification No. 22/F-1-7/18-3/98, dated June 8, 1998, under the Madhya Pradesh Municipal Corporation Act, 1956 (23 of 1956) ;

(6) Gorakhpur including the areas defined as development area as notified by the Uttar Pradesh State Government from time to time in exercise of the powers under section 3 of the Uttar Pradesh Urban Planning and Development Act, 1973 (President's Act No. 11 of 1973) ;

(7) Guwahati including the areas comprised in the City of Guwahati within the meaning of Guwahati Municipal Corporation Act, 1971 (Assam Act 1 of 1973) ;

(8) Gwalior including the areas as notified under the Madhya Pradesh Municipal Corporation Act, 1956 (23 of 1956) ;

(9) Hubli-Dharwad including the areas as notified by the Government of Karnataka in the Notification No. HUD.378. MLR 95, dated October 12, 1995, and any subsequent amendments in the said notifications;

(10) Jalandhar including the areas as notified by the Municipal Corporation, Jalandhar ;

(11) Jodhpur including the areas as notified by the Government of Rajasthan in the Notification No. F. 1(12)TP/72, dated September 1, 1977, issued under the Rajasthan Urban Improvement Act, 1959 (35 of 1959) ;

(12) Kota including the areas as notified by the Government of Rajasthan under the Rajasthan Urban Improvement Act, 1959 (35 of 1959);

(13) Mysore including the areas as notified by the Karnataka Government in the Notification No. HUD.444.MLR 95, dated November 30, 1995, and any subsequent amendments in the said notification ;

(14) Nasik including the areas comprised in the Municipal Corporation of Nasik as constituted under the Bombay Provincial Municipal Corporation Act, 1949 (LIX of 1949);

(15) Rajkot including areas within Rajkot Municipal Corporation as defined in the Schedule to the Gujarat Municipality Act, 1963, and the areas included in the city of Rajkot vide Government of Gujarat Notification No. KV-68-1988-RMN-8095-3120P, dated June 17, 1998 ;

(16) Ranchi including the areas comprised in the Ranchi Municipal Corporation (Division of Ranchi into Wards) Rules, 1981 ;

(17) Salem including the areas comprised in the Salem Municipal Corporation within the meaning of the Salem City Municipal Corporation Act, 1994, in G.O. Ms. No. 153 (MA & WS), dated June 1, 1994 ;

(18) Solapur including the areas comprised in the Municipal Corporation of Solapur as constituted under the Bombay Provincial Municipal Corporation Act, 1949 (LIX of 1949) ;

(19) Tiruchirapalli including the areas that are comprised in the Tiruchirapalli Municipal Corporation within the meaning of Tiruchirapalli City Municipal Corporation Act, 1994 in G.O. Ms. No. 151, dated June 1, 1994.

[Notification No. 10864/F. No. 142/2/99-TPL]

What a notification is. A notification is made under a power the Act itself gives, and within that power it is law — unlike a circular, which only binds the department. Its reach is the reach of the enabling provision and no wider, and the date it carries decides from when it works.
